Arsenal's long-term aim for Gabriel Martinelli offers insight into transfer plan

mirror.co.uk, 13 November 2021, 21:50
Arsenal are expected to offload a number of players when the transfer window reopens in January, but one player that will be staying is Gabriel Martinelli

Arsenal have no intention of allowing Gabriel Martinelli to leave the club in January, according to the player's father.

Martinelli has struggled for minutes this term, making just four starts in all competitions.

But Mikel Arteta has named him in the matchday squad for every Premier League game and he is still clearly an important part of the Spaniard's project moving forward.

Amid speculation linking Martinelli with a loan move to Corinthians, Joao Martinelli revealed there is "no chance" he will be on the move with Arsenal willing to rebuff any approaches.

"No chance of him going to Corinthians or any other Brazilian club," Joao told Yahoo via Sport Witness. "Since he came back from an injury, he's been playing a lot less than he'd have liked.

"There have even been some proposals from Europe, but Arsenal have already warned that they'll not release him."

Arteta admits that the Brazilian's lack of playing time is simply down to the fact that he is behind other forwards in the Arsenal pecking order.

"Well because of the amount of players we have in those positions, he had some games that he played," he said last month.

"We have a lot of trust with Gabi and we need to find space for him to grow within the squad.

"If you look at the number of games he's played the injuries have been a big setback for him, we sometimes forget his age and we need to try and help him maintain that balance because you can generate frustration that comes out of, in my opinion, a not very realistic diagnosis and we need time."

And with the majority of Arsenal's squad away on international duty, Martinelli has remained at London Colney with an eye on improving in the role Arteta sees him in long term, centre-forward.

Football.London claim the 20-year-old was deployed as a central striker during a training game, working on holding the ball with his back to goal.

"[Aubameyang and Martinelli] are centre forwards but with the squad balance that we have at the moment, to play in those positions on the left we don't have five players," Arteta explained last year.

That goes against the wishes of the player himself who previously suggested his favourite position was on the left side of a front-three.

But with players like Emile Smith Rowe, Nicolas Pepe, Bukayo Saka and Pierre-Emerick Aubameyang all able to play in that role, competition is fierce.

It's a different story leading the line however and options could become even more sparse amid reports Alexandre Lacazette and Eddie Nketiah could leave the club in the January window.

Should both of those depart, once Aubameyang goes to the African Cup of Nations, Marinelli could be handed the chance to spearhead Arsenal's attack.

The change of position could also point to the fact that Arteta and technical director Edu are willing to wait until the end of the season to truly replace Lacazette with Martinelli offering them the precious commodity of time.
